The sole purpose of “Together Against Wind” is to provide an effective link between the Houses of Parliament and both individuals and Groups campaigning against the proliferation of wind turbines across large areas of our countryside.
“Together Against Wind” is a simple not for profit organisation set up to bring Collective strength to the many campaign groups fighting against wind farms in the UK.
It is designed to complement existing campaigns and will hopefully help deliver a cohesive message, so that we get a strong clear statement with one voice and through this achieve success. It is essentially what our opponents have been doing, remember how they ensured that wind subsidies were cut by only 10% rather than the proposed 25% in the review that took place in the summer of 2012.
“Together Against Wind” is run by Chris Heaton-Harris MP and has a simple aim of changing government policy which is currently at risk of causing industrialization of our countryside on an unprecedented scale. It will encourage a two way flow of information between the Houses of Parliament and those groups and individuals fighting wind turbine applications. In particular it will:
- Set up campaigns to raise awareness among MP’s of the serious impact that wind turbines are having on rural communities.
- Provide information to campaign groups and individuals about activity within parliament and seek support when appropriate.
- Undertake research projects designed to provide information to assist in driving parliamentary campaigns and fighting wind farm proposals across the country.
